Description
The Flame Sensor Module is a reliable fire detection sensor designed to detect flame or fire sources using infrared light.
It can sense flame wavelengths typically in the 760nm – 1100nm range, making it ideal for fire alarm systems, safety projects, and robotics applications.
This module provides digital output (and some variants also support analog output), allowing easy integration with microcontrollers like Arduino, ESP32, STM32, and Raspberry Pi. 🔧 Technical Specifications
-
Sensor Type: Flame / Fire Detection Sensor
-
Detection Wavelength: 760nm – 1100nm (Infrared)
-
Output: Digital (Some versions support Analog)
-
Operating Voltage: 3.3V – 5V DC
-
Interface Pins: VCC, GND, DO (AO optional)
-
Adjustable sensitivity via potentiometer
